Description

Completely redesigned for this season, the Petzl Tikka XP 2 Headlamp is versatile, powerful, and has 5 lighting modes. Similar to the Tikka Plus 2 headlamp, the Tikka XP 2 integrates to light sources and is equipped with 1 high output white LED and 1 red LED, but the Tikka XP 2 features a wide angle lens, allowing you to choose between a long distance focused beam or flood beam proximity lights. Delivering over 60 lumens of lighting power, the Tikka XP 2 can shine up to 60 meters and light your path for up to 160 hours, in white economy mode. The red light LED option offers better night vision and can be used as a blinking light for safety or a call for rescue. Now easier to operate, the Tikkia XP 2 has a hinged battery compartment that opens wide, an original push-button switch to shift between lighting modes, and a battery charge indicator light, so you won't get caught in the dark. If you are looking for a small, lightweight, energy efficient headlamp that doesn't compromise visibility and shines bright, the Petzl Tikka XP 2 Headlight will deliver. Specifications

  • Versatile and powerful
  • Three lighting modes (maximum and economic and flash)
  • Two red lighting modes (Continuous and blinking)
  • Focused or wide bean with wide angle lens
  • One high output while LED, 60 lumens, shines up to 60 meters
  • Flashing modes for communicating a need for rescue or alerting others in urban environment
  • Integrated whistle aids calling for help during daytime or when visibility is limited
  • Electronic push-button switch
  • Battery pack is easy to open
  • Light beam can be aimed
  • Adapt system is quick to mount
  • Push button switch limits inadvertently turning on lamp during storage
  • Battery charge indicator
  • Compatible with lithium batteries
  • Compact, light and comfortable
  • Single compartment contains LEDs and batteries
  • Adjustable headband
  • Battery life: White LED: 80h (Maximum), 160h (Economic), 240h (Flash), Red LED: 100h (Maximum), 750h (Blinking)
  • Max distance: White LED: 60m (Maximum), 17m (Minimum), 8400m (Flashing), Red LED: 1000m
  • Weight: 88g (including batteries)

Good headlamp for running Used this headlamp for Cascade Lakes Relay and Hood to Coast Relay. Dispersive light for seeing the edge of the road. Focal light for seeing further ahead on the road. No bouncing. No headaches (needed to tighten up other headlamps to prevent bouncing which caused headaches). Convenient for seeing around the campsite or field at night or early morning. Highly recommend this headlamp. October 26, 2010
